To help homeowners who need access to the Internet and fax machines to file claims and forms, three Hennepin County Library branches in Minneapolis -- Northeast, 2200 Central Av. NE.; Pierre Bottineau, 55 NE. Broadway St.; and Sumner, 611 Van White Memorial Blvd. – were open Monday from 1 to 8 p.m.

The libraries, normally closed on Mondays, also provide "space for the community to come together," Library Director Lois Langer Thompson said. - Kevin Duchschere
